I've been to Pripyat and it all LOOKS quite normal - abandoned yes, derelict yes, but otherwise normal. If the leaf mould wasn't decaying, the place would be knee high in the stuff and it isn't. It looks the was I imagine Stevenage would after being abandoned for 25 years.

People live in the area (not so many of course permanently - but one woman in particular never moved away and is growing her own veg which she trades with people visiting the area - mostly the guides) and they aren't having to sweep up constantly.

That said, I don't think I would choose to live there. But then I wouldn't choose to live in Stevenage either.
